"Alechinsky on Paper" at the Pierre André Benoit Museum, Alès

Summary by UP' Magazine
From 20 June 2025 to 4 January 2026, the Museum-Library PAB (Pierre André Benoit) in Alès gives carte blanche to Pierre Alechinsky, a major figure in contemporary art. This unique exhibition of his work on paper, gathered close to 200 works rarely presented – drawings, engravings, marouflé papers and artist's books – and covers eight decades of creation.
